DY02 MXL is a 2002 Subaru Legacy in Red with a 2,457c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.2%.
Across all 2002 Subaru Legacy models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.6% with a typical mileage of 93,093 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Subaru Legacy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 11,876 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DY02 MXL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Legacy typ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 24 years old, this Subaru Legacy is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
